Bally Total Fitness Holding  (GREY:BLLYW) 6-1 Month Momentum % Calculation

6-1 Month Momentum % is calculated as following:

6-1 Month Momentum %=( Price 1-month ago / Price 6-month ago - 1 ) * 100 %

Bally Total Fitness Holding  (GREY:BLLYW) 6-1 Month Momentum % Explanation

Momentum investing is a trading strategy in which investors buy securities that are rising and sell before the prices start to go back down. The 6-1 Month Momentum % measures the total return to a stock over the past six months, but ignores the previous month.

The reason why the most recent month’s return dropped related to the short-term reversal effect associated with momentum. There is an academic finding that short-term momentum actually has a reversal effect, whereby the previous winners (measured over the past months) do poorly the next month, while the previous losers do well the next month. In order to eliminate the short-term reversal effect, the previous month return was not included in this calculation.

Bally Total Fitness Holding is the largest commercial operator of fitness centers in the United States in terms of revenue, number of members, and square footage of facilities. The company operates more than 400 fitness centers with approximately 4 million members. Its fitness centers are generally 30,000 square feet in size and include such amenities as a workout area, sauna and steam facilities, a lap pool, free-weight rooms, aerobic-exercise rooms, an indoor jogging track, and racquetball courts.
